Solution for (3+x)y=14 equation:


Simplifying
(3 + x) * y = 14

Reorder the terms for easier multiplication:
y(3 + x) = 14
(3 * y + x * y) = 14

Reorder the terms:
(xy + 3y) = 14
(xy + 3y) = 14

Solving
xy + 3y = 14

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3y' to each side of the equation.
xy + 3y + -3y = 14 + -3y

Combine like terms: 3y + -3y = 0
xy + 0 = 14 + -3y
xy = 14 + -3y

Divide each side by 'y'.
x = 14y-1 + -3

Simplifying
x = 14y-1 + -3

Reorder the terms:
x = -3 + 14y-1
